广州IO总线应用

时间:2024年08月02日 来源:

尽管分布式总线IO系统具有许多优点,但也存在一些潜在的缺点需要考虑:复杂性:分布式总线IO系统通常比传统的集中式IO系统更为复杂。它涉及到多个IO模块之间的通信和协调,需要进行适当的配置和编程。这可能需要更多的技术知识和专业技能来设计、安装和维护系统。成本:尽管分布式总线IO系统可以减少布线成本,但其本身的硬件和软件成本可能较高。分布式总线IO系统通常需要专门的硬件设备和接口模块,这些设备可能比传统IO设备更昂贵。此外,由于分布式总线IO系统的复杂性,可能需要更多的工程师和技术支持来进行系统集成和维护,增加了人力成本。故障排查:由于分布式总线IO系统涉及多个模块和通信链路,当系统发生故障时,排查和定位问题可能更加复杂。故障可能发生在任何一个IO模块、通信线路或软件配置上,需要仔细的故障排查和测试来确定问题的根源。依赖性:分布式总线IO系统的性能和可靠性可能依赖于网络通信的稳定性和可靠性。如果网络出现故障或延迟,可能会影响数据传输和控制操作的实时性。因此,对于对实时性要求较高的应用,需要特别关注网络的可靠性和带宽。在分布式总线IO系统中,可以使用统一的编程接口和标准化的协议进行设备的开发和集成。广州IO总线应用

分布式总线IO本身并不直接支持与第三方API集成。分布式总线IO主要是负责处理IO设备之间的通信和数据交换,而与第三方API的集成通常需要通过软件层面进行。要实现与第三方API的集成,可以在分布式总线IO系统中添加适当的软件模块或驱动程序,以实现与第三方API的通信和数据交换。这些软件模块或驱动程序可以根据第三方API的要求,使用适当的通信协议和接口标准与API进行交互。具体而言,集成分布式总线IO与第三方API可能涉及以下步骤:开发或获取适用于分布式总线IO的驱动程序或软件模块,以实现与第三方API的通信。根据第三方API的要求,配置和设置分布式总线IO系统,确保与API的连接和通信正常运行。在应用程序中使用第三方API的相关功能和接口,通过分布式总线IO传输数据或接收数据。广州IO总线应用分布式总线IO可以通过将输入设备和输出设备连接到分布式总线来实现系统间的数据交换。

分布式总线IO通常支持实时数据处理。实时数据处理是指对数据进行即时处理和响应,以满足实时性要求。在安防监控设备和云管理平台中,实时数据处理非常重要,因为它可以帮助及时检测和响应事件,提供及时的告警和通知。分布式总线IO可以通过高速数据传输和低延迟的通信机制,将设备产生的实时数据传输到云端或其他处理节点。在云管理平台或其他处理节点上,可以使用实时数据处理技术,如流式处理、复杂事件处理等,对数据进行实时分析、过滤、聚合和决策。这些处理结果可以用于实时监控、实时报警、实时调整设备配置等应用。需要注意的是,实时数据处理的性能和延迟受到分布式总线IO的带宽、处理节点的计算能力以及网络延迟等因素的影响。因此,在设计和部署分布式总线IO系统时,需要综合考虑这些因素,以确保实时数据处理的效果和性能满足需求。

分布式总线IO具有以下几个主要的优点:高性能:分布式总线IO可以提供高带宽和低延迟的数据传输能力。通过将IO功能分散到多个节点中并利用并行处理的特性,分布式总线IO可以实现更高的数据吞吐量和更快的响应时间,满足对高性能IO的需求。可扩展性:分布式总线IO可以轻松扩展到大规模系统。通过增加节点数量和利用分布式计算的优势,分布式总线IO可以实现线性的扩展性,从而满足不断增长的数据处理需求。高可靠性:分布式总线IO通过将IO功能分散到多个节点中,降低了系统的单点故障风险。即使某个节点发生故障,其他节点仍然可以继续处理IO请求,保证了系统的可靠性和可用性。灵活性:分布式总线IO可以适应不同的应用场景和需求。它可以与不同类型的网络和物理介质结合使用,支持多种IO协议,从而满足各种不同的应用需求。分布式总线IO可以提供可扩展性和模块化设计,使得系统可以根据需求进行扩展和升级。

分布式总线IO可以支持实时监控。实时监控是指对系统中的IO设备和数据进行实时监测和跟踪,以确保系统的正常运行和及时发现可能的故障或异常情况。在分布式总线IO中,可以通过以下方式实现实时监控:状态监测和报警:监测IO设备的状态和性能指标,例如设备的工作状态、传输速率、错误率等。当设备状态或性能指标超出预设的阈值时,系统可以发出警报,通知管理员或运维人员进行相应的处理。错误检测和纠正:分布式总线IO通常包含错误检测和纠正机制,用于检测和纠正传输过程中可能发生的错误。这些机制可以实时监测传输的数据,并检测错误的出现。一旦发现错误,系统可以根据纠正机制进行自动纠正或通知操作员进行处理。诊断和排错工具:分布式总线IO通常提供一些诊断和排错工具,用于帮助管理员或运维人员分析和解决IO设备故障。这些工具可以实时监测设备的状态、收集和分析设备的日志信息,以帮助确定故障的原因并提供相应的解决方案。通过实时监控,系统可以及时发现和处理IO设备故障或异常情况,提高系统的可靠性和稳定性。同时,实时监控还可以提供对系统性能和资源利用情况的实时了解,帮助管理员做出相应的优化和调整。在分布式总线IO系统中,各个设备通过总线进行通信,可以实现高效的数据传输和设备管理。广州IO总线应用

分布式总线IO可以支持设备的动态配置和参数调整,适应不同的应用场景和需求。广州IO总线应用

分布式总线IO的关键组成部分通常包括以下几个方面:总线协议:分布式总线IO使用特定的总线协议来定义节点之间的通信规则和数据格式。总线协议规定了数据传输的方式、帧格式、错误检测和纠错机制等。常见的总线协议包括CAN总线、Ethernet/IP、Modbus等。节点:节点是分布式总线IO系统中的通信单元,可以是传感器、执行器、控制器或其他设备。每个节点都有一个只有的地址,用于在总线上进行识别和通信。节点可以发送和接收数据,并根据总线协议的规定进行通信操作。总线物理层:总线物理层定义了节点之间的物理连接方式和电气特性。它规定了总线的传输介质(如双绞线、同轴电缆、光纤等)、传输速率、信号电平和电气特性等。总线物理层的设计需要考虑数据传输的可靠性、抗干扰性和传输距离等因素。总线控制器:总线控制器是分布式总线IO系统中的关键组件,负责管理总线的通信和数据传输。总线控制器可以实现总线协议的解析和生成,处理数据帧的发送和接收,以及错误检测和纠错等功能。它与节点进行通信,并协调节点之间的数据交换。广州IO总线应用

信息来源于互联网 本站不为信息真实性负责